GTA Service - denial of benefit of 75% abatement in the absence of any declaration furnished by the transport agencies - There is no merit in the submissions that even without declaration as stipulated in the notification, the assessee was entitled to such exemption, is over simplifying or glossing over the conditions itself, which cannot be permitted. - Tribunal was perfectly justified in denying such exemption.
